I have been waiting now for 13 days (not the 7-10) and finally got the letter which is such a crock! Word for word this is what it says...
Dear Jane Doe
Thank you for your application for a (n) GE Money Bank Care Credit account. Regretfully, your request cannot be approved at this time.
In evaluating your request, a credit scoring system was used that meets detailed standards for such systems set out in the regulation implementing the provisions of the Federal Equal Credit Opportunity Act. This system assigns a point value to various items of information which, taken together, have been demonstrated to predict the statistical probability that a consumer will pay in accordance with the terms of the transaction requested. The points obtained each factor or characteristic considered by the scoring system were added together and you did not achieve the approval score assigned by the system. Since each category scored by the system contributed to the total score, no individual factor was solely responsible for your score being less than the approved score. Nevertheless, the factors where you did not score well compared with other consumers have been determined and these factors were:
-age of oldest account 8 years 8 months
-too few accounts currently paid as agreed not a late reported ever
-lack of finance company account information really not sure about this everything appeared to be correct the day I app'd
-lack of recent retail account information maybe they didn't like I haven't used Jcp? But use all other cards?
In evaluating your application, the consumer reporting agency below provided us with information that in whole or part influenced our decision. The consumer reporting agency played no part in our decision other than providing us with credit information about you and is unable to supply specific reasons why we have denied credit to you. You have the right under the Fair Credit Reporting Act to know the information contained in your credit file. You also have a right to a free copy of your report from the credit reporting agency, if you request it no later than 60 days after you receive this notice. In addition, if you find any information contained in the report you receive is inaccurate, you have the right to dispute the matter with the credit reporting agency. Any questions regarding such information should be directed to the consumer reporting agency below;
